首頁 >資料庫 >mysql教程 >如何使用MySQL建立文件管理表實現文件管理功能

如何使用MySQL建立文件管理表實現文件管理功能

PHPz
PHPz原創
2023-07-01 20:43:401629瀏覽

如何使用MySQL建立檔案管理表實作檔案管理功能

引言:
在現代社會中,檔案管理是我們工作和生活中不可或缺的一部分。隨著電子化和數位化的發展,文件管理變得更加重要。 MySQL作為一種常用的關聯式資料庫管理系統,可以幫助我們實現檔案管理功能。本文將介紹如何使用MySQL建立文件管理表,並透過程式碼範例示範如何實作文件管理功能。

步驟一:建立檔案管理表
首先,我們需要在MySQL中建立一個檔案管理表。此表將用於儲存檔案的基本訊息,如檔案名稱、大小、類型、儲存路徑等。以下是一個範例的檔案管理表的建立語句:

CREATE TABLE file_management (
    id INT AUTO_INCREMENT PRIMARY KEY,
    file_name VARCHAR(255) NOT NULL,
    file_size INT NOT NULL,
    file_type VARCHAR(50) NOT NULL,
    file_path VARCHAR(255) NOT NULL
);

在上面的建立語句中,我們定義了一個名為file_management的表,包含五個欄位: id(檔案ID,自增主鍵)、file_name(檔案名稱)、file_size(檔案大小)、file_type(檔案類型)和file_path(檔案儲存路徑)。

步驟二:插入檔案記錄
建立好檔案管理表後,我們可以透過插入記錄的方式向表格新增檔案資訊。以下是一個範例的插入語句:

INSERT INTO file_management(file_name, file_size, file_type, file_path) 
VALUES ('file1.txt', 1024, 'txt', '/var/files/file1.txt');

在上面的範例中,我們插入了一個名為file1.txt的檔案記錄,檔案大小為1024字節,檔案類型為txt,儲存路徑為/var/files/file1.txt

步驟三:查詢檔案記錄
一旦有檔案記錄被插入到檔案管理表中,我們可以使用SELECT語句來查詢該表中的檔案記錄。以下是一個範例的查詢語句:

SELECT * FROM file_management;

執行上面的查詢語句後,將傳回檔案管理表中的所有檔案記錄。

步驟四:更新檔案記錄
如果需要更新檔案記錄(如修改檔案名稱、檔案大小等),可以使用UPDATE語句來實作。以下是一個範例的更新語句:

UPDATE file_management SET file_name = 'file2.txt' WHERE id = 1;

上面的範例中,我們更新了ID為1的檔案記錄的檔案名稱file2.txt

步驟五:刪除檔案記錄
如果需要刪除某個檔案記錄,可以使用DELETE語句來實現。以下是一個範例的刪除語句:

DELETE FROM file_management WHERE id = 1;

上面的範例中,我們刪除了ID為1的檔案記錄。

結論:
透過上述步驟,我們可以使用MySQL建立檔案管理表,並實作檔案管理功能。當然,上述範例只是一個簡單的示範,實際應用中可能需要更複雜的功能和業務邏輯。但無論如何,MySQL提供了強大的資料管理和查詢功能,為我們實現檔案管理功能帶來了便利和便利。

希望本文能幫助讀者了解如何使用MySQL建立檔案管理表並實作檔案管理功能。透過靈活應用MySQL的功能,我們可以更好地管理和組織我們的文件資源,提高工作效率和生活品質。

附註:文章中的範例程式碼僅用於示範和說明目的,可能與實際情況有所不同,讀者可根據自己的實際需求進行相應的修改和應用。

以上是如何使用MySQL建立文件管理表實現文件管理功能的詳細內容。更多資訊請關注PHP中文網其他相關文章!

陳述:
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n